WA bushfire threat weakens in Perth's east
AAP
A bushfire that broke containment lines is now stationary and no longer threatening lives and homes in Perth's east.
An advice warning has been reissued for people in the western part of Wattle Grove and the northern part of Orange Grove in the City of Gosnells and the Shire of Kalamunda.
The Department of Fire and Emergency Services says the accidental blaze was sparked at 1pm on Wednesday.
